The Prostate Cancer Score in 77374, Thicket, Texas is 26 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

92.31 percent of the population in 77374 drive to work alone. 7.69 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 37.76 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 18.18 percent of the residents in 77374 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.68 members with about 2.27 cars available per household.

An estimate of 95.10 percent of the residents in 77374 has some form of health insurance. 59.91 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 56.35 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 77374 would have to travel an average of 28.83 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Cleveland Emergency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 77374, Thicket, Texas.

As of , an estimate of 449 residents live in 77374 with a median age of 52.2 years. 24.72 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 24.28 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 30.43 percent of the residents in 77374 is currently married, and 32.74 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 77374 is $6,286.75.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 77374 is approximately $382. The median household spends about 6.08 percent of their income on housing.
